Usually the ™ and ® symbols are shown in a superscript form at the end of the trademark (for example, Apple®). As well, in addition to using trademark symbols, you can also highlight your trademark with bolded font, italics, or by using all capital letters so that it stands out from adjacent words.

WebWhen a trademark is specifically used for services, it is commonly referred to as a service mark. Examples of service marks include DHL, HILTON, and INFOSYS. However, as the distinction between goods and services isn’t always clear-cut, the term “trademark” is often used to encompass service marks as well. WebInfringement. They distinguish the goods or services of one trader from another and can take many forms; for example words, slogans, logos, … penfold projects qldWebWhereas ® is used for registered trademarks. However, it is an offence under the TMA to use the ® symbol without valid registration. According to Section 104 of TMA, using the ® symbol without registration may result in a fine of RM10,000 .
